  • How to upgrade Oracle BPEL PM

    Dear experts,
    Is it possible to upgrade Oracle BPEL PM 10.1.3.1 to 10.1.3.4 or we have to reinstall from beginning.
    Thanks
    Rajesh

    Hi Rajesh,
    SOA Suite 10.1.3.1.0 is a base version and 10.1.3.4 is a patchset that needs to be applied on top of 10.1.3.1.0.
    So. when you start the 10.1.3.4 patchset OUI, you need to give the 10.1.3.1.0 OH path, so that 10.1.3.4 gets applied on this existing OH.
    Now, your SOA will be 10.1.3.4 version. Please follow the readme of 10.1.3.4 before applying the 10.1.3.4 patchset.

  • How aware is Oracle 9i/10g of multiple CPUs?

    We currently have a SunFire V880 with 4 CPUs. There is a plan to purchase another 4 CPUs for that same box. I was wondering if there was an optimal configuration for Oracle (with regards to CPUs).
    Can Oracle use that many CPUs?
    Is there a limit to how many CPUs Oracle can use effectively?
    During what circumstances does Oracle use multiple CPUs?

    It's the operating system a lot more than Oracle that takes care of using the various CPU's in a system. If Oracle has more than 8 concurrent threads/processes (depending on the operating system), the operating system should ensure that all the CPU's are being used. In a dedicated server configuration, assuming you have more than 4 concurrent users, going from 4 to 8 CPU's may be beneficial. If you spend a lot of time doing single-threaded ETL, though, you may need to increase your degree of parallelism to use more than 1 CPU.
